OPO green power

We seem to be running into repeated problems where the green power is not sufficient to get to the nominal OPO green transmitted power.

Today the SHG output was particular low, so I adjusted the input pointing as well as lowered the temperature to 35.0C (from 35.5C). This gave us about 10% more green power, but still not enough! I then further increased the green power by adjusting the waveplate in front of the cube.

The rejected power (H1:SQZ-SHG_REJECTED_DC_POWERMON) is currently showing 1.8mW, down from around 4.7mW when I started. There is a little bit further to go, but we may have to realigning the green fiber coupler on the table. And if this doesn't work, we probably need to coonsider moving the OPO crystal.

Adding some plots related to Daniel's assesment above.  The first time cursor (in the first attachment) is Oct 3 2024, the time of our most recent OPO crystal move 80451, you can see that the SHG launch power and OPO refl power have climbed back up as crystal losses have increased. 

The second attachment shows that since Daniel's intervention described above (the time when SHG rejected power drops), the SHG power has been more stable, and the ISS control signal has been around 3V.  I think that this means we can wait until Monday to move the crystal, so that we can do the temperature adjustments as we settle into our new crystal position during the workweek rather than over the weekend.
